Background: Diabetic foot ulcer (DFU) is one of the most terrifying diabetic complications for patients, due to the high mortality rate and risk for amputation. During the COVID-19 pandemic, many diabetic patients limited their visits to the hospital, resulting in delays for treatment especially in emergency cases. Objective: This study aimed to compare the characteristics of patients with DFU pre- and during COVID-19 pandemic period. Methods: This study was a retrospective cohort study using foot registry data. We compared our patients’ characteristics pre-COVID-19 pandemic period (1 March 2019-28 February 2020) and during COVID-19 pandemic period (1 March 2020-28 February 2021). Results: Cohorts of 84 and 71 patients with DFU pre- and during COVID-19 pandemic period, respectively, were included in this study. High infection grade (66.7% vs 83.1%, P = .032), osteomyelitis event (72.6% vs 87.3%, P = .04), leukocyte count (15 565.0/μL vs 20 280.0/μL, P = .002), neutrophil-to-lymphocyte ratio (7.7 vs 12.1, P = .008), waiting time-to-surgery (39.0 h vs 78.5 h, P = .034), and number of major amputation (20.2% vs 39.4%, P = .014) were significantly higher during the COVID-19 pandemic period. Conclusion: During the COVID-19 pandemic, patients with DFU had more severe infection, higher proportion of osteomyelitis, longer waiting time for getting surgical intervention, and higher incidence of major amputation.
Epidemiological studies have indicated that rural living might be protective against type 2 diabetes development. We compared the metabolic profile and response to a short-term high-fat high-calorie diet (HFD) of men with the same genetic background living in an urban and rural area of Indonesia. First, we recruited 154 Floresian male subjects (18–65 years old), of whom 105 lived in a rural area (Flores) and 49 had migrated and lived in urban area (Jakarta) for more than 1 year. The urban group had significantly higher whole-body insulin resistance (IR), as assessed by homeostatic-model-assessment of IR (HOMA-IR), [mean difference (95% CI), p-value: 0.10 (0.02–0.17), p = 0.01]. Next, we recruited 17 urban and 17 rural age-and-BMI-matched healthy-young-male volunteers for a 5-day HFD challenge. The HOMA-IR increased in both groups similarly −0.77 (−2.03–0.49), p = 0.22]. Neither rural living nor factors associated with rural living, such as current helminth infection or total IgE, were associated with protection against acute induction of IR by HFD.

The substantial increase in the prevalence of non-communicable diseases in Indonesia might be driven by rapid socio-economic development through urbanization. Here, we carried out a longitudinal 1-year follow-up study to evaluate the effect of urbanization, an important determinant of health, on metabolic profiles of young Indonesian adults. University freshmen/women in Jakarta, aged 16–25 years, who either had recently migrated from rural areas or originated from urban settings were studied. Anthropometry, dietary intake, and physical activity, as well as fasting blood glucose and insulin, leptin, and adiponectin were measured at baseline and repeated at one year follow-up. At baseline, 106 urban and 83 rural subjects were recruited, of which 81 urban and 66 rural were followed up. At baseline, rural subjects had better adiposity profiles, whole-body insulin resistance, and adipokine levels compared to their urban counterparts. After 1-year, rural subjects experienced an almost twice higher increase in BMI than urban subjects (estimate (95%CI): 1.23 (0.94; 1.52) and 0.69 (0.43; 0.95) for rural and urban subjects, respectively, Pint < 0.01). Fat intake served as the major dietary component, which partially mediates the differences in BMI between urban and rural group at baseline. It also contributed to the changes in BMI over time for both groups, although it does not explain the enhanced gain of BMI in rural subjects. A significantly higher increase of leptin/adiponectin ratio was also seen in rural subjects after 1-year of living in an urban area. In conclusion, urbanization was associated with less favorable changes in adiposity and adipokine profiles in a population of young Indonesian adults.
Background/Aims: Ramadan fasting creates changes in lifestyle, causing biochemical alterations that affect glucose metabolism and insulin sensitivity. This study aims to assess the impact of Ramadan fasting on glycemic control and Fetuin-A, a glycoprotein that affects insulin resistance, in patients with type 2 diabetes mellitus (T2DM). Materials and methods: This was a prospective study done among 37 patients with T2DM from Internal Medicine Polyclinic in a hospital in Jakarta, Indonesia. Anthropometric data as well as Hemoglobin A1c (HbA1c), Fasting Blood Glucose (FBG), and Fetuin-A levels of the subjects were measured in three time points: before, during, and after Ramadan fasting. A bivariate analysis was done to see the effect of Ramadan fasting on those parameters. Results: Ramadan fasting reduced Fetuin-A levels [median (minimum-maximum), 5.35 (2.91-7.81) vs. 3.22 (2.35-5.60) mg/dl; p ¼ 0.039] four weeks after the end of Ramadan compared to pre-Ramadan. After two weeks of Ramadan fasting, we found a significant reduction in body weight, BMI, FBG, and HbA1c levels which rebounded to baseline level after Ramadan. Conclusion: Ramadan fasting was associated with a significant decrease in Fetuin-A level post Ramadan.
Pendahuluan. Pada negara dengan keterbatasan sumber daya, pengukuran viral load (VL) sebagai prediktor efektivitas terapi antiretroviral (ARV) tidak selalu mudah untuk diakses oleh pasien HIV yang mendapat terapi ARV. Pada penelitian-penelitian sebelumnya, kepatuhan berobat (adherens) diketahui merupakan faktor penting terhadap supresi VL HIV. Penelitian ini bertujuan untuk mengetahui faktor prediktor kegagalan virologis pada pasien HIV yang mendapat terapi ARV lini pertama sesuai paduan ARV terbaru dengan kepatuhan berobat yang baik di Indonesia.Metode. Studi kohort retrospektif dilakukan pada pasien HIV rawat jalan dewasa di Rumah Sakit dr. Cipto Mangunkusumo (RSCM), Jakarta yang memulai terapi ARV lini pertama selama periode Januari 2011-Juni 2014. Pasien HIV dengan kepatuhan berobat baik yang mempunyai data VL 6-9 bulan setelah mulai terapi ARV dimasukkan sebagai subjek penelitian. Kegagalan virologis dinyatakan sebagai nilai VL ≥400 kopi/mL setelah minimal 6 bulan terapi ARV dengan kepatuhan berobat baik. Usia awal terapi ARV, faktor risiko penularan HIV, stadium klinis HIV menurut World Health Organization (WHO), koinfeksi HIV-TB, jumlah CD4 awal terapi, peningkatan jumlah CD4, kadar hemoglobin dan indeks massa tubuh awal terapi, perubahan berat badan selama terapi, dan basis paduan terapi ARV merupakan variabel yang diteliti pada penelitian ini. Hasil. Terdapat 197 pasien sebagai subjek penelitian ini. Kegagalan virologis ditemukan pada 21 pasien (10,7%). Peningkatan CD4 <50 sel/mm3 setelah minimal 6 bulan terapi merupakan prediktor kegagalan virologis (p = 0,003; OR 5,802, 95% CI= 1,842-18,270). Terdapat peningkatan risiko kegagalan virologis pada pasien dengan terapi ARV berbasis NVP pada saat VL diperiksa, namun tidak bermakna secara statistik (p = 0,060; OR 2,756; 95% CI= 0,958-7,924). Simpulan. Peningkatan CD4 <50 sel/mm3 setelah minimal 6 bulan terapi dapat memprediksi kegagalan virologis pada pasien yang mendapat terapi ARV lini pertama dengan kepatuhan berobat yang baik. Antiretroviral therapy (ART) effectively suppress HIV replication. Viral load (VL) measurement is better predictor than clinical or immunological criteria to evaluate success or failure of ART. However, in country with limited resources, viral load measurement is not easily accessible by HIV patients receiving ART. Therefore, it is necessary to know which factors that can predict virological failure. In previous studies, adherence was an important factor for suppression of HIV viral load. This study is aimed to know predictors of virological failure in HIV patients receiving recent first line ART regimen with good adherence in Indonesia. Methods. A retrospective cohort study was conducted among adult HIV patients in Out-patient Clinic of Cipto Mangunkusumo Hospital that started ART during periode of January 2011-June 2014. HIV patients with good adherence that had viral load data 6-9 months after initiation of ART were included in this study. Virological failure was defined as viral load ≥ 400 copies/mL after minimum of 6 months therapy with good adherence. Age at starting ART, risk factor for HIV infection, HIV clinical stage, HIV-TB co-infection, baseline CD4 value, CD4 count increase, baseline hemoglobin level and body mass index, weight changes during therapy, and ART based regimen were analyzed in this study. Results. A total of 197 patients were included in this study. Virological failure was found in 21 patients (10,7%). CD4 increase <50 cell/mm3 after minimum 6 months of ART was predictor of virological failure (p = 0,003; OR 5,802, 95%CI 1,842-18,270). Conclusion. CD4 increase <50 cell/mm3 after minimum 6 months therapy can predict virological failure in HIV patients receiving first line ART with good adherence.
